如何使用PHP函数传参来生成4位随机数
在PHP中,我们可以使用rand()函数来生成随机数。rand()函数可以接受两个参数,代表了生成随机数的范围。下面我们将讨论如何使用rand()函数来生成一个4位数的随机数。
1. 首先,我们需要确定随机数的范围。一个4位数范围应该为1000到9999之间,因为最小的4位数是1000,最大的4位数是9999。所以我们将rand()函数的参数设置为1000和9999。
```php
$random_number = rand(1000, 9999);
```
上述代码将生成一个1000到9999之间的随机数,并将结果保存在变量$random_number中。
2. 接下来,我们可以将生成的随机数输出,以验证我们的结果。
```php
echo "随机数为:" . $random_number;
```
上述代码将输出类似于“随机数为:4567”的结果。
3. 另一种方法是将生成的随机数当作函数的返回值,这样我们可以在其他地方使用这个随机数。
```php
function generate_random_number() {
return rand(1000, 9999);
}
$random_number = generate_random_number();
echo "随机数为:" . $random_number;
```
上述代码定义了一个名为generate_random_number()的函数,该函数使用rand()函数生成一个随机数,并将其作为返回值。然后,我们使用这个函数将生成的随机数保存在变量$random_number中,并输出结果。
4. 如果我们需要生成多个4位随机数,我们可以通过将代码放入循环中来实现。
```php
$random_numbers = array();
for($i = 0; $i < 10; $i++) {
$random_numbers[] = generate_random_number();
}
echo "生成的随机数为:";
print_r($random_numbers);
```
上述代码将生成10个随机数,并将它们保存在名为$random_numbers的数组中。然后,我们使用print_r()函数将数组的内容输出。
总结:
使用PHP函数传参来生成4位随机数非常简单。我们可以使用rand()函数,并将范围参数设置为1000和9999。然后,我们可以选择将生成的随机数直接输出或将其作为函数的返回值。如果需要生成多个随机数,我们可以通过将代码放入循环中来实现。这些技巧可以帮助我们在开发中生成所需的随机数。 如果你喜欢我们三七知识分享网站的文章, 欢迎您分享或收藏知识分享网站文章 欢迎您到我们的网站逛逛喔!https://www.ynyuzhu.com/
发表评论 取消回复